Fine Rates, Overdues & Charges
- Student fine rates: fines are not charged for books or audio visual items returned or renewed after their due date unless they have been requested by another borrower
- $3 per day for overdue items that have been requested by another borrower (i.e. in high demand), or for overdue short-term loans or recalled items. If another copy is returned and all requests are filled, fines automatically stop at that point until the item is returned to the Library.
- A maximum charge of $45 is applied for recalled items i.e. items that are overdue and have been requested by another borrower.
- Short Loan Collection items: $1 per hour, or part thereof, for late return. An additional $15 fine may be imposed on overdue overnight loans.
All borrowers will be prevented from borrowing, renewing or placing requests if:
- Fines total $45 or more
- An item reaches 10 days overdue
- A recalled item is 1 day or more overdue
- Your University fees have not been paid
Very Overdue Items
Any item still overdue at 28 days will be invoiced at a default item charge, plus a processing fee. If the item is a high demand item i.e. requested by another borrower, fines of $3 per day up to the maximum of $45 will also be applied.
If you have lost a book or it has been damaged while on loan to you it must be reported as soon as possible. Please email Library@massey.ac.nz or phone 0800 MASSEY (0800 627 739).
Outstanding Library Debt
If after a period of 10 days you fail to respond to the 28 day invoice, return the item/s or make arrangements for payment you will be sent a final letter. This letter advises that:
- your Library access will expire within 7 days from the date of the letter
- your access to Library electronic resources may be blocked
- after another 7 days your name will be lodged at Registry. Your university registration will be cancelled and your Stream access will be denied. You may be unable to receive exam results, graduate or re-enrol.
If left unresolved the debt may be referred to a debt collection agency.
